Top definition
Tore up from the floor up. Somebody that is a complete and absolute mess, disaster, from top to bottom, physically and mentally. Having trouble looking and acting okay in society.
She's been on H for so long, she's tora flora.
by snowyowl94 April 16, 2007
Get the mug
Get a tora flora mug for your brother James.